    Hm. It's swinging, its very nice, couldn't find it in realbooks old or new. Not considered a jazz standard?

    I tried to figure out the chords from Armstrong's version and this is what I got:

    INTRO
    || C Ebdim D- G7#9#5 ||

    A
    ||: C C C [C/E Ebdim] |

    | D- C#dim D- C#dim |

    | D- C#dim D- G7 |

    |1. C C#dim G9#11 :||

    |2. C [F G7] C (C)||

    B
    || F- Bb13 Eb C7 |

    | F- Bb13 Eb Eb |

    | E- G7 C- C- |

    | A- D7 G G7 ||
    A
    ||...........
    | C C D- G7 ||


    If you know it and find mistakes, please let me know.
